So, what went down? CrowdStrike had a Q1 earnings report that beat expectations, but honestly, it wasn’t as big of a win as bulls were hoping for. That led to some serious selling pressure. Yeah, it stung a bit. This was the stock’s worst drop in 22 months. Ouch!
Now, why did this happen? Well, even though the earnings looked decent on paper, folks were expecting a bit more excitement. Investors are always looking for that next big thing, and when they feel like a company’s just not delivering, they hit the sell button fast. Plus, there’s a lot of chatter around competition in the cybersecurity space, especially with names like Fortinet and Palo Alto getting some love lately. Jim Cramer even mentioned them alongside CrowdStrike, so that’s a vibe check for investors.
Also, it’s worth mentioning that CrowdStrike has been on a tear this year, up 83% in 2026 alone! That’s a big deal, but it seems like some people are starting to wonder if it’s fully valued. With all the buzz around AI security and the upcoming Fal.Con 2026 event, there’s a lot for investors to think about.
To wrap it up, CrowdStrike had a decent day on the surface, but the market’s reaction shows that people are a bit cautious after earnings. Remember, investing is all about the long game, and sometimes things get a little bumpy.
